King Luther Capital Management Corp Raises Position in Pinnacle Financial Partners, Inc. (NASDAQ:PNFP)

King Luther Capital Management Corp boosted its holdings in Pinnacle Financial Partners, Inc. (NASDAQ:PNFPFree Report) by 6.2% in the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 75,392 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 4,413 shares during the period. King Luther Capital Management Corp owned approximately 0.10% of Pinnacle Financial Partners worth $6,034,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

About Pinnacle Financial Partners

(Free Report)

Pinnacle Financial Partners,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as the bank holding company for Pinnacle Bank that provides various banking products and services to individuals, businesses, and professional entities in the United States. The company accepts various deposits, including savings, noninterest-bearing and interest-bearing checking, money market, and certificate of deposit accounts; and provides treasury management services, which includes online wire origination, enhanced ACH origination services, positive pay, zero balance and sweep accounts, automated bill pay services, electronic receivables processing, lockbox processing, and merchant card acceptance services.
